Bridge Closing Will Inconvenience Drivers

W. Tilghman Street bridge to close for 5 1/2 months.

Editor's Note: In this column, we look ahead to important issues that will face Upper Macungie residents next year.

Summary: that runs above Chapmans Road will begin undergoing PennDOT repairs for a 5 1/2-month period, beginning in March. Engineers from Keystone Consulting Engineers told that the bridge will be closed from March 13, 2012 to Aug. 6, 2012.

Outlook: PennDOT's initial estimate for repairs was two years, but crews will work 12-hour shifts, 7 days a week to shorten the repair time. Detours will be set up from Interstate 78 to Route 100 to Route 309 for truck traffic. No truck traffic will be allowed at the intersection of Chapmans and Ruppsville roads. A temporary stop sign will be placed at W. Tilghman and Farm Bureau Road for access into the Green Hills neighborhood and to facilitate a school bus stop.
